Missing Text in Print Output
When I print a PDF as hardcopy, individual letters are disappearing from the printed document, but are still present in the online view. The letters that vanish are often the same letter, such as all the G's and g's. Not in all cases, though.
I am using Reader X on WIn 7. PDF was generated from Word 2010 using "Save as". Can anyone help?
Did you use "Save As" or "Save As Adobe PDF" ?
Try the below steps:-
1. Create the PDF using PDF Maker plugin in word application and then print the PDF.
2. If you are using a postscript printer then in Print dialog click on Advanced and under "font and resource policy" set the dropdown value to "send for each page". Then try to print the document.
3. As a workaround you can use "print as image" option in the same advanced print setup dialog box.

Item text of PO print output is not generatiing but text is updated in PO
Hello ,
I am changing the PO through IDOC. When ever there is change in the quantity ,net price and delivery date the print out put is generated autoamtically and changes are appearing the print output.
when ever there is change in the item text of PO print output is not generatiing but item text is updated in the PO.
If i change manually print out is generating for item text also but through IDOC print output is not generated . please help to slove this isuue.
i am passing the value as :
idoc_data-segnam = 'E1BPMEPOTEXT'.
e1bpmepotext-po_item = Po line item number .
e1bpmepotext-text_id = txtid.
e1bpmepotext-text_form = textform.
e1bpmepotext-text_line = line item text .
idoc_data-sdata = e1bpmepotext.
APPEND idoc_data.
CLEAR idoc_data.
CLEAR e1bpmepotext.
please help me it is urgent
Thanks
VenkateshHi,
For triggering the output for changes you have to make some changes.
- Go to SM30
- Enter view name "<b>VV_T161M_EF</b>".
- Hit 'maintains' view.
- Now let's say your outpu type is 'NEU'. For this there will be one entry like this.
Operat. Ctyp. Name Short text Update
1 NEU Purchase order New
Now with this entry add one more entry like this.
Operat. Ctyp. Name Short text Update
2 NEU Purchase order Change X
You just need to enter Operat. = 2 and Ctyp = NEU. The 'name' and 'short text' will come automatically.
- Save your entry and create.
After doing this, your PO will trigger output on change.

I just spent 3 days creating a book [32 pages], with photos and text but when I click Buy Book In iPhoto this appears>
Our book appears to have default text that has not been edited. Printed books will not include this text. Do you want to continue?
My question is will the text I have sellected to use still be ok, am I safe to continue and buy or will the book have missing text ?
The book is for special birtday in 2 weeks time Please Help.G
<Email Edited by Host>Yes, you're safe to continue. That means that there are text boxes that you did not put any text into and they contain the holding text which will not be printed. That text is shown in a light grayt and is in Latin. Normally you can just put a space in the text box to replace the holding text so as not to get that warning message.
Before ordering the book proof the book according to this Apple document: iPhoto, Aperture: Previewing an order in iPhoto or Aperture. Check the pdf file for any missing text or photos and any warning indicators in the text boxes indicating that some of the text has exceeded the space allotted in the text box.
Keep the pdf file to compare with the printed copy when you reciive it.

Attribute "Report Layout" is missing in the "Print Attributes" tab for IR
Hallo,
The attribute “Report Layout” is missing in the “Print Attributes” tab for an interactive report?
How to alter the report layout (xsl-fo) of an interactive report?
Has someone any idea where to configure this?
Btw, for the "classic" SQL Report the XSL-FO "Report Layout" can be cahnged in "Print Attributes" and this works fine for me. But I want to change the xsl-fo for the interactive report.
"If you do not select a report layout, a default XSL-FO layout is used. The default XSL-FO layout is always used for rendering Interactive Report regions. ... Unlike classic reports, the Interactive Report Print Attributes can only utilize the default XSL-FO layout and is initiated from the Report Attributes, Download section rather than directly from this screen. Once configured, these attributes only apply only to the current region and cannot be used outside the context of the region."
http://apex.oracle.com/i/doc/bldapp_rpt_print.htm
How can the "default XSL-FO layout" be changed?
Changing is necessary because the Apache FOP 1.0 reports the following error (for the transmitted default XSL-FO):
"fo:simple-page-master", "fo:region-body" must be declared before "fo:region-before"
http://www.w3.org/TR/xsl/#fo_region-before
The default report layout is not saved in:
select * from APEX_040000.WWV_FLOW_REPORT_LAYOUTS
Thx, WilliI've found two workaround for getting Apache FOP 1.0 to work with Oracle Apex 4.0 for PDF printing of interactive reports:
1, Use an application process to set your custom layout for interactive reports:
[ ] grant all on APEX_040000.WWV_RENDER_REPORT3 to {YOUR_SCHEMA_NAME};
[ ] Create an Application Process e.g. "Custom Report Layout" with constraint for request 'PDF' and Process Text:
declare
v_xsl varchar2(32767);
begin
v_xsl := '<?xml version = ''1.0'' encoding = ''utf-8''?>
<xsl:stylesheet version="2.0"
<fo:region-body region-name="region-body" margin-top="54.0pt" margin-bottom="54.0pt"/>
<fo:region-before region-name="region-header" extent="54.0pt"/>
</xsl:stylesheet>';
APEX_040000.WWV_RENDER_REPORT3.g_prn_template := v_xsl;
end;2, If you have some knowlege in Java change the sequnce of the the nodes in the apex_fop.jsp (or servlet), ie. changing the xsl before you use it for transformation.
The code depends on the solution you are using to parse the xsl string.
